Travel Corporation brands cut
prices by up to 20% for a month The Travel Corporation’s touring brands are offering discounts of up to 20% for UK and worldwide trips between August 2021 and November 2022. The deals are part of the month-long Global Take Off Sale launched for Trafalgar, Insight Vacations and Luxury Gold. A new 15% discount across all trips can be combined with a 5% discount for past guests.

Classic Collection bids for bookings with ‘Commitment’
Classic Collection Holidays has launched a ‘Classic Commitment’ policy to boost consumer confidence and bookings. It promises a ‘100%
Cancellation Guarantee’, offering full cash refunds if the holiday cannot be provided, and no amendment fee for changes to bookings. Si Morris-Green, agency sales
and marketing director, said: “We know there is huge pent-up demand. People want to be able to book an overseas holiday in 2021 but uncertainty surrounding travel regulations is leading to an understandable hesitancy. “Our Classic Commitment aims
to reassure our agent partners and mutual customers their bookings are safe and secure with us. “We are making commitments
on amendment fees, refunds and Covid-compliancy, giving customers the confidence they need in order to book now.” Classic is offering a £100
voucher as a thank you to customers who amend a booking, rather than cancel. The Classic Commitment
is available on selected current bookings and is applicable to all new bookings made from February 1.

Windows on the Wild creates five-star trips with Luxe brand
Windows on the Wild has launched a sister brand, Windows on the Wild Luxe, offering five-star wildlife and adventure holidays. A 10-night trip to Thanda Island Private Marine Reserve, off the coast of Tanzania, costs from £8,845 based on a group of 18 travelling in November. It includes business-class flights from Gatwick and seven nights’ exclusive, all-inclusive use of Thanda Island.

Limitless Travel introduces
accessible safari in South Africa Accessible holidays specialist Limitless Travel has rescheduled the launch of a South African safari itinerary, originally planned for 2020, to 2021. The 12-day escorted tour features game drives in Isimangaliso Wetland Park, a cat and cheetah rehabilitation centre and a boat trip. Departures start in September, with prices from £2,999 including flights and accommodation.

Explore unveils tours in Malta, Greece, Turkey and Chernobyl
Juliet Dennis
Explore has brought out four new small-group tours in Europe this year. The adventure operator has put together the
additional walking and active itineraries and off-season trips on the back of increased demand for outdoor holidays and European destinations. Departures are planned from early summer, with the
new Active Greece trip offered in May, and Walking in Malta & Gozo in June, while two off-peak winter tours, Winter in Turkey and Winter Chernobyl Photography Break, are offered in November 2021. Trips for 2022 are also now on sale for all four new
tours and for most trips in Explore’s portfolio. Explore’s head of global sales, Ben Ittensohn, said:
“We know our customers want something to look forward to, and many are turning to Europe and active outdoors holidays for their next trip.” The 10-night Active Greece trip is priced from

£1,630 excluding flights, or £1,892 with flights, and includes accommodation and breakfast, most activities and excursions and a local leader. The trip to northern Greece offers a hike into the Vikos Gorge, whitewater rafting on the Voidomatis River, and learning how to make spanakopita (spinach pie) in the fishing village of Galaxidi. It also includes climbing, cycling and e-biking. Explore is encouraging agent partners to use its new
appointment booking system on its website to learn more about the trips from its business development managers. Dedicated promotional materials have also been created for agents and can be downloaded to use on social media.
